In this fascinating discussion about his memorable Sharks career, legendary lock and former captain Mark Andrews opens up on his near-decade at the Shark Tanks.

Mark recalls starting out as an amateur before the incredible transformation from Natal to the Sharks in the professional era.

Along the way Mark experienced unprecedented success in Durban, helping the Sharks win the Currie Cup twice, reaching two additional finals and also reaching the Super 12 final twice.

Then unbelievably in 2002 he was told he had nothing left to offer.  Mark discusses all of these topics candidly and shares a few funny moments along the way too in this memorable episode of Front Row Rugby.
